#46266f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#46266f is composed of 27.5% red, 14.9% green and 43.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 36.9% cyan, 65.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 56.5% black. It has a hue angle of 266.3 degrees, a saturation of 49% and a lightness of 29.2%. #46266f color hex could be obtained by blending #8c4cde with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333366.

Shades and Tints of #46266f

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050309 is the darkest color, while #fbf9f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#46266f

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#4a484d is the less saturated color, while #420491 is the most saturated one.
